Punk, Bullets and Junk (PBJ) is a blockchain-based multiplayer extraction shooter developed within the Gala Games ecosystem. The project combines fast-paced PvPvE combat, exploration of a post-apocalyptic world, valuable resource gathering, and Web3 technology. Rather than making the digital economy the core of the gameplay, the developers focus on preserving the familiar mechanics of modern online shooters while using blockchain to verify ownership of selected in-game assets. This approach reflects the current evolution of GameFi, where gameplay quality takes priority over financial mechanics.

1. What Is Punk, Bullets and Junk and What Makes It a Web3 Shooter
Punk, Bullets and Junk is a multiplayer extraction shooter that combines survival, exploration, and competitive PvPvE gameplay. Players venture into dangerous zones, gather valuable resources, battle enemies, and attempt to safely extract from the map with their loot.
The project is being developed within the Gala Games ecosystem, which is known for creating Web3 games that support digital ownership. Unlike many blockchain games, however, PBJ prioritizes engaging gameplay over Play-to-Earn mechanics, maintaining the familiar pace and feel of modern online shooters.
The game features a post-apocalyptic setting where players explore ruined environments, face numerous threats, and compete for limited resources. This structure makes every session unpredictable and requires players to constantly adapt to changing conditions.
Blockchain technology is used to verify ownership of selected in-game assets without altering the core shooter mechanics. As a result, the game remains accessible to both traditional online gamers and Web3 enthusiasts.
2. Gameplay, PvPvE Mechanics, and Character Progression
The core gameplay loop revolves around expeditions into hazardous combat zones. Players must explore the environment, search for useful equipment, collect valuable resources, and survive encounters with both AI-controlled enemies and other players.
Successfully extracting from a mission allows players to keep their collected loot, which can then be used to upgrade equipment, improve their character, and prepare for future raids. Every decision involves risk, since dying during an expedition may result in losing part of the carried gear.
Key gameplay features include:
- PvPvE combat;
- exploration of post-apocalyptic environments;
- resource and valuable item collection;
- character progression;
- weapon and equipment upgrades;
- solo and cooperative expeditions;
- tactical planning for every raid.
This system makes every match a unique experience where success depends on preparation, efficient resource management, and the ability to quickly react to opponents' actions. Even experienced players must continuously adjust their strategies depending on the situation.
The gameplay is further enhanced by inventory management, extraction route planning, and the constant need to evaluate potential rewards against possible risks before entering each new mission.
3. NFTs, Digital Assets, and the Gala Games Ecosystem
One of Punk, Bullets and Junk's defining features is the integration of digital ownership within the Gala Games ecosystem. Certain in-game items, cosmetic collectibles, and other assets can be represented as NFTs that verify player ownership.
Blockchain technology enables these assets to exist independently of the game servers and, when supported, interact with compatible services across the broader Gala ecosystem. However, owning NFTs does not replace player skill or determine the outcome of matches.
The Gala Games ecosystem also provides infrastructure for managing digital assets, interacting with other platform projects, and supporting a shared gaming economy. This creates a unified environment where users can engage with multiple Web3 games.
This architecture lowers the entry barrier for newcomers by allowing players to first enjoy the gameplay before deciding whether to explore blockchain-based ownership features.

4. How Punk, Bullets and Junk Compares to Other GameFi Projects
Punk, Bullets and Junk differs from most GameFi projects by focusing primarily on extraction-based gameplay and competitive PvPvE mechanics rather than on its economic model. Blockchain serves as an additional technological layer while preserving a traditional gaming experience.
This approach makes the project appealing both to fans of competitive online shooters and to players interested in exploring Web3 technology. The key differences are summarized below.
| Feature | Punk, Bullets and Junk | Typical GameFi Project |
|---|---|---|
| Genre | Extraction PvPvE Shooter | RPG, Strategy, or Card Game |
| Main Focus | Gameplay and Tactical Combat | Game Economy |
| NFTs | Game Assets and Cosmetic Items | Characters, Land, or Equipment |
| PvPvE | Core Gameplay Feature | Rarely Implemented |
| Character Progression | Equipment and Experience | Varies by Project |
| Web3 Integration | Enhances Gameplay | Often Becomes the Main Mechanic |
This model combines the strengths of modern online gaming with blockchain technology without changing the familiar principles of competitive shooters. Players can focus on exploration, character progression, and teamwork while benefiting from optional digital ownership.
As the GameFi sector continues to mature, projects like PBJ are becoming increasingly attractive by delivering a complete gaming experience alongside additional Web3 functionality.
